When considering a private jet from London to New York, cost is a top concern for business travelers. While it is true that chartering a jet is typically more expensive than flying commercially, the benefits and time savings can outweigh the price tag. It is recommended to reach out to multiple charter companies for quotes and compare prices before making a decision. Jet charters from London to New York typically start around $70,000 and go up to $150,000.
This price may be split among passengers if traveling as a group, making it a cost-effective option for business travelers. For an exact quote on your next charter, reach out through our flight search form above.

Before embarking on your private jet journey from London to New York, proper planning is paramount.
When chartering a private jet to New York from London, careful planning is essential. It is advisable to book your jet well in advance to secure the desired aircraft and departure time. Additionally, consider the amount of baggage you will be bringing and make arrangements accordingly.
Ensure that you have all necessary travel documents with you, including your passport and any required visas. Once you have completed the check-in process, you will be escorted to your aircraft, ready for takeoff.
On the day of departure, arrive at the private terminal at the designated time. Private jet terminals often have dedicated parking and expedited check-in processes. While security measures are still in place, they tend to be more efficient compared to commercial airports.
The flight time on a private jet from London to New York can vary depending on several factors, including the type of aircraft, weather conditions, air traffic, and specific routing.
On average, the flight time for a private jet between these two cities is approximately 8 hours. The distance is 3460 miles.

Reach out to multiple charter companies and compare prices to ensure you are getting the best deal.
Take the time to research the reputation and reliability of the charter company before making a reservation.
Consider Additional Expenses: In addition to the base cost of the charter, consider any additional fees or services that may be required, such as catering or ground transportation.
Look for Empty Legs: Empty legs are flights that are returning to their base airport without passengers. These flights can be significantly discounted and offer a cost-effective option for those with flexibility in their travel plans.
